M&S said in a statement that it had "been a challenging quarter for the general merchandise market, with unseasonal conditions and higher than ever levels of discounting". The retailer said it had seen "early signs of improvement" in womenswear sales.The retailer said it had seen "early signs of improvement" in womenswear sales.
M&S staged a flash sale on the Saturday before Christmas, with 30% reductions off clothing lines, which the company said on Thursday would hit margins.
Mr Bolland said the food business, which contributes more than half of group sales, had an "excellent" quarter. On 23 December, the chain had its biggest day yet for food, with sales of £64m, he said.

Also on Thursday, Tesco reported like-for-like sales down 2.4% in the six weeks to 4 January because of a "weaker grocery market".
At the same time, rival Morrisons reported a 5.6% drop in like-for-like sales.
